Job description

Job Title: English Teacher (MPS/UPS) - R&R + TLR for the right candidate, Epsom

This is a full-time, permanent position at a reputable school in Epsom, seeking a dedicated English Teacher to inspire students and contribute positively to the English department.

Location:

Epsom

Job Category:

Education / Teaching

Minimum Requirements:
  1. Qualified teacher status (QTS or equivalent).
  2. Experience teaching English Language and Literature at KS3 and KS4; KS5 experience is desirable.
  3. Strong classroom management skills and passion for English.
  4. Ability to engage students of varying abilities.
  5. Commitment to professional development and fostering a love of reading and writing.
  6. Ability to work collaboratively within a team.
  7. Willingness to adhere to safeguarding policies.
Job Responsibilities:
  • Plan and deliver engaging English lessons.
  • Differentiate instruction to meet student needs.
  • Assess and monitor student progress, providing feedback.
  • Create a positive, inclusive classroom environment.
  • Collaborate with colleagues and contribute to curriculum development.
  • Communicate with parents/guardians effectively.
  • Follow safeguarding policies and procedures.
